How do his godly traits relate to his god? Hermes was the Messenger of the Gods, unsurpassed in speed. Jubs' digitigrade feet give him better traction, and are more suited to running than a normal plantigrade human foot. Hermes was always depicted wearing a winged hat and winged sandals, and the feathers growing on Jubs imitate this.
